タグ付けされた質問 「multipartform-data」


2
multipart / form-dataリクエストを送信するためのツール[終了]
閉まっている。この質問はスタックオーバーフローのガイドラインを満たしていません。現在、回答を受け付けていません。 この質問を改善してみませんか? Stack Overflowのトピックとなるように質問を更新します。 3年前休業。 現在、Chrome Addon Postman-REST Clientを使用して、POST / GETリクエストを簡単に作成しています。 アップロードスクリプトをデバッグしたいのですが、ファイルも送信できるように、「multipart / form-data」としてエンコードされたリクエストを作成するツールを探しています。

14
jQuery.ajaxでmultipart / formdataを送信する
jQueryのajax関数を使用してサーバーサイドのPHPスクリプトにファイルを送信するときに問題が発生しました。ファイルリストを取得する$('#fileinput').attr('files')ことは可能ですが、このデータをサーバーに送信するにはどうすればよいですか?ファイル入力を使用する$_POSTと、サーバーサイドのphp-script の結果の配列()は0(NULL)になります。 私はそれが可能であることを知っています(今までjQueryソリューションは見つかりませんでしたが、Prototyeコードのみ(http://webreflection.blogspot.com/2009/03/safari-4-multiple-upload-with-progress.html) )。 これは比較的新しいようですが、XHR / Ajaxを介したファイルのアップロードは確実に機能しているため、XHR / Ajax経由でのアップロードは不可能であることを述べないでください。 Safari 5の機能が必要です。FFとChromeはいいですが、必須ではありません。 今の私のコードは: $.ajax({ url: 'php/upload.php', data: $('#file').attr('files'), cache: false, contentType: 'multipart/form-data', processData: false, type: 'POST', success: function(data){ alert(data); } });



17
JSオブジェクトをフォームデータに変換
JSオブジェクトをどのように変換できFormDataますか? 私がこれをしたい理由は、〜100フォームのフィールド値から作成したオブジェクトがあるためです。 var item = { description: 'Some Item', price : '0.00', srate : '0.00', color : 'red', ... ... } 次に、アップロードファイルの機能をフォームに追加するように求められます。これはもちろん、JSONでは不可能なので、に移動することを計画していFormDataます。JSオブジェクトを変換できる方法はありますFormDataか?


14
HTTP POST multipart / form-dataを使用してファイルをサーバーにアップロードする方法は?
私はWindowsPhone8アプリを開発しています。MIMEタイプmultipart / form-dataと "userid = SOME_ID"という文字列データを使用したHTTPPOSTリクエストを使用してPHPWebサービス経由でSQLiteデータベースをアップロードしたいと思います。 HttpClient、RestSharp、MyToolkitなどのサードパーティのライブラリを使用したくありません。以下のコードを試しましたが、ファイルがアップロードされず、エラーも発生しません。Android、PHPなどで正常に動作しているため、Webサービスに問題はありません。以下は私の与えられたコードです(WP8用)。どうしたんだ? グーグルで検索しましたが、WP8に固有のものではありません async void MainPage_Loaded(object sender, RoutedEventArgs e) { var file = await Windows.ApplicationModel.Package.Current.InstalledLocation.GetFileAsync(DBNAME); //Below line gives me file with 0 bytes, why? Should I use //IsolatedStorageFile instead of StorageFile //var file = await ApplicationData.Current.LocalFolder.GetFileAsync(DBNAME); byte[] fileBytes = null; using (var stream = await …
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.